Biological Delivery Systems

Pathogens have adapted to efficiently introduce DNA sequences into target cells, making them an effective tool for DNA-based treatment. Common biological delivery agents consist of:

Adenoviruses – Able to penetrate both dividing and static cells but may provoke immune responses.

Adeno-Associated Viruses (AAVs) – Highly regarded due to their reduced immune response and capacity for maintaining long-term DNA transcription.

Retroviral vectors and lentiviral systems – Integrate into the cellular DNA, offering sustained transcription, with HIV-derived carriers being particularly useful for altering dormant cellular structures.

Alternative Genetic Delivery Methods

Alternative gene transport techniques present a less immunogenic choice, diminishing adverse immunogenic effects. These include:

Lipid-based carriers and nano-delivery systems – Packaging nucleic acids for effective intracellular transport.

Electrical Permeabilization – Applying electric shocks to open transient channels in plasma barriers, permitting nucleic acid infiltration.

Targeted Genetic Infusion – Introducing genetic material directly into localized cells.

Treatment of Genetic Disorders

Numerous inherited conditions originate in single-gene mutations, rendering them suitable targets for DNA-based intervention. Some notable advancements include:

Cystic Fibrosis – Research aiming to incorporate working CFTR sequences indicate potential efficacy.

Clotting Factor Deficiency – Gene therapy trials aim to restore the biosynthesis of coagulation proteins.

Dystrophic Muscle Disorders – Genome engineering via CRISPR delivers promise for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y patients.

Sickle Cell Disease and Beta-Thalassemia – DNA correction techniques aim to rectify red blood cell abnormalities.

DNA-Based Oncology Solutions

DNA-based interventions are crucial in tumor management, either by altering T-cell functionality to eliminate cancerous growths or by reprogramming malignant cells to halt metastasis. Several highly effective tumor-targeted genetic solutions include:

Chimeric Antigen Receptor T-Cell Engineering – Reprogrammed immune cells focusing on malignancy-associated proteins.

Cancer-Selective Viral Agents – Engineered viruses that specifically target and eliminate malignant tissues.

Tumor Suppressor check over here Gene Therapy – Restoring the function of growth-regulatory genetic elements to control proliferation.


Curing of Infectious Conditions

Molecular therapy offers potential solutions for long-term illnesses like Human Immunodeficiency Virus. Experimental procedures comprise:

CRISPR-Based HIV Elimination – Directing towards and eliminating pathogen-bearing structures.

Genetic Modification of Immunocytes – Altering Lymphocytes defensive to infection.

Unraveling the Science of Advanced Genetic and Cellular Treatments

Cellular Treatments: The Power of Live Cell Applications

Cell-based medicine leverages the regenerative potential of human tissues to treat diseases. Major innovations encompass:

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plants (HSCT):
Used to manage oncological and immunological illnesses by replacing damaged bone marrow via matched cellular replacements.

CAR-T Immunotherapy: A cutting-edge anti-cancer strategy in which a person’s lymphocytes are enhanced to target with precision and eliminate cancer cells.

Regenerative Stem Cell Treatment: Investigated for its clinical applications in alleviating autoimmune-related illnesses, orthopedic injuries, and neurodegenerative disorders.

DNA-Based Therapy: Altering the Fundamental Biology

Gene therapy works by repairing the underlying problem of genetic diseases:

Direct Genetic Therapy: Injects DNA sequences inside the biological structure, including the clinically endorsed Spark Therapeutics’ Luxturna for treating genetic eye conditions.

Cell-Extraction Gene Treatment: Consists of genetically altering a biological samples in a lab and then reinjecting them, as utilized in some clinical trials for hemoglobinopathy conditions and immune deficiencies.

The advent of genetic scissors CRISPR-Cas9 has greatly enhanced gene therapy clinical trials, making possible targeted alterations at the genetic scale.
